At Fidamc, innovation is not only reflected in laboratories or R&D projects, but also in the way people are encouraged and supported. The organisation is undergoing a profound transformation, not only technologically, but also in human terms. We spoke to Cristina Alia, Director of Human Resources, to learn more about Next to You, the programme that brings together the company's wellness, development and work-life balance initiatives, and to reflect on how talent and leadership are evolving in the ever-changing field of composite materials.

How did the idea for the Next to You programme come about and what are its objectives?

The idea arose from a conversation with our CEO, in which we set ourselves the challenge of creating a global programme that would bring together and give coherence to all the actions we carry out in terms of well-being, development, work-life balance and benefits for people.

Until then, we had numerous initiatives, but they were not integrated under a single structure. There was no framework to present them in an orderly, clear and accessible way for everyone.

The main objective of 'Next to You' was precisely that: to give visibility and coherence to everything Fidamc does to take care of its team, highlighting not only the tangible benefits, but also those aspects that reflect our commitment to the comprehensive wellbeing and personal and professional development of our people.

The programme covers a wide range of areas, from training to work-life balance. What aspects do you think have the greatest impact on the team's well-being?

Without a doubt, flexibility and work-life balance measures are among the most valued aspects. They allow people to balance their personal and professional lives, something that more and more people are prioritising. But I would also highlight development and continuous learning.

The younger generations are not just looking for a job, but for a company whose values align with their own. Among other things, they value social responsibility, diversity, work-life balance and wellbeing.

So, it is not enough to attract talent: you have to retain it, and to do that, you have to motivate it. That is the essence of Next to You.

Next to You is also committed to personal and professional development. How does Fidamc ensure that this growth is individualised?

Our goal is to accompany each person's development in a personalised way, helping each professional to visualise their progress and strengths. To do this, we are promoting a model that allows us to identify skills, detect potential and design development plans tailored to each person.

The key is to differentiate between performance and potential, something that remains a challenge in many organisations. Leadership cannot be limited to measuring results: it must inspire, develop and accompany.

That is why we work with our leaders to ensure they are authentic role models, capable of fostering learning and helping each person achieve their best.

As we often say, the manager has killed the boss: leadership based on collaboration and empathy has replaced the authoritarian and hierarchical command of the past.

In a sector as technical as composites, how does Human Resources contribute to driving innovation?

Innovation does not come solely from technology, but from the people who make it possible. Our role in Human Resources is to create the right environment for that innovation to flourish.

We do this through agile processes, digital tools and a collaborative culture that allows people to focus on adding value. We also encourage continuous training, ensuring that our teams are always up to date and able to develop their full potential.

The transformation of the sector is enormous (digitalisation, automation, sustainability, artificial intelligence), but behind every advance there are always people. If we invest in them today, the future of the sector will take off stronger than ever.

What sets Fidamc apart in terms of talent management?

What sets us apart is the close relationship and comprehensive approach we take to our work. At Fidamc, we firmly believe that people are the driving force behind innovation. We are committed to a culture of trust, flexibility and transparency, where everyone feels listened to and valued.

Furthermore, we see talent management as a complete cycle: attracting, developing and retaining. In the past, it was human resources managers who sought out candidates, but now it is the candidates who seek out and choose where they want to work.

In one sentence, how would you define 'Next to You?

'Next to You' reflects Fidamc's commitment to people: a way of telling them that we are by their side, accompanying them in their professional development and personal well-being.
